
DSP...............
文章平均质量分 64
Marvin_wu
这个作者很懒,什么都没留下…
展开
-
DM6437-读写SRAM测试过程
硬件平台:DM6437EVM调试工具:CCS3.3编写SDRAM 读写程序:Uint32 memfill_print( Uint32 start, Uint32 len, Uint32 val ){ Uint32 i; Uint32 end = start + len; Uint32 errorcount = 0; /* Write Patte原创 2013-11-18 18:32:02 · 3351 阅读 · 0 评论 -
[DM8168] EVM816x DDR2/3 PRCM Init is Done(DMM_LISA_MAP 修改 EMIF 映射)
DM8168样板制作过程,CCS测试DDR3时,GEL加载不通过:遇到EVM816x DDR2/3 PRCM Init is Done .....卡住的问题。一般是三个原因:①fly-by结构的地址时钟命令线焊接不良。②DDR3某芯片异常。③时序参数改变,而寄存器并没有被正确配置。①③情况还好解决,碰到②可以通过修改EMIF映射的方式回避损坏的DDR3芯片。比如现成的案原创 2015-11-12 16:27:14 · 2015 阅读 · 0 评论 -
纪念2014 TI DSP大奖赛
偶然发现TI官网有新闻报道大奖赛,还有沈洁女士给我们颁奖的照片,纪念一下。第六届TI DSP及嵌入式大奖赛决赛暨颁奖典礼在厦门大学成功举行Frances Han 2013-2014 TI DSP及嵌入式大奖赛决赛暨颁奖典礼于4月24日、25日在有着中国最美校园之称的厦门大学成功举行。本次竞赛经过8个月的激烈角逐,共有37个参赛队在全国上百个参赛队中脱颖而原创 2014-05-13 22:31:09 · 1900 阅读 · 2 评论 -
DM8168 nandflash启动出现卡死(问题)
上次测试SD卡启动linux没有成功,就把nandflash芯片给焊上了用ccs5.3进行jtag调试,测试到了nandflash工作正常,并用nand-flash-writer.out将u-boot烧写进nandflash,仿真器是XDS560,这次有进展,但还是有问题,随机的有三种情况。拨码开关设置 4:0 10010第一种启动信息:U-Boot 2010.06 (De原创 2013-12-02 13:20:13 · 2996 阅读 · 0 评论 -
CCS error: symbol trace buf is defined multiple times
DSP-BIOS和XDC工程建立过程中出现以下链接错误,导致编译失败。 [Linking...] "C:\CCStudio_v3.3\C6000\cgtools\bin\cl6x" -@"Debug.lkf">> error: symbol trace$buf is defined multiple times: C:\dvsdk_1_01_00_原创 2013-11-09 22:19:35 · 3786 阅读 · 2 评论 -
DM8168 OSD Algorithm (DSP side)
osdLink_alg.c:/******************************************************************************* * * * Copyright (c) 2009原创 2015-01-13 16:22:19 · 2205 阅读 · 0 评论 -
DM8168硬件平台
DM8168硬件平台 作者:Marvin_wu TMS320DM8168是一款多核SoC,它集成了包括ARM Cortex A8、DSP C674X+、M3 VIDEO、M3 VPSS等处理器。DSP用于视频图像处理,ARM负责应用程序管理及各个外设的控制,M3 VIDEO主要功能是对视频帧进行编码和解码,而M3 VPSS则负责原创 2014-11-07 12:17:24 · 2801 阅读 · 1 评论 -
DM8168 电源调试总结
经过几天的焊接调试,DM8168需要的十余种电源终于调通。 过程中遇到了不少问题。原创 2013-11-05 19:06:03 · 2438 阅读 · 0 评论 -
DM8168 DVR RDK nand系统移植
Nand boot 准备:方法一:将DM8168的启动方式设置为SD卡启动,U-boot启动完成后,使用U-boot将nandflash适用的bootloader烧写到DM8168。方法二:也是我选用的方法,简单粗暴,使用CCS工程将 uboot_NAND_DM816X_TI_EVM 烧写到nandflash,前提是有仿真器。烧写方法之前提到过:http://blog.youkuaiyun.com原创 2014-11-17 22:40:10 · 2099 阅读 · 0 评论 -
DM8168 开机自动运行程序
①home目录创建自动运行的shell:# vi test.sh②将test.sh拷贝到/home/root下:# mov test.sh /home/root③修改Profile文件:# vi /etc/profile④结尾添加:cd /home/rootsh test.sh原创 2014-11-01 17:15:41 · 1221 阅读 · 0 评论 -
DM8168 自动登录root用户
①指定连接:# ln -s /bin/busybox /sbin/getty②修改/etc/inittab文件:# vi /etc/inittabS:2345:respawn:/sbin/getty 115200 ttyO2 -n -l /bin/autologin③创建自动登录shell:# vi /bin/autologin#!/bin/shexec /bi原创 2014-11-01 14:00:05 · 1602 阅读 · 0 评论 -
DM8168 ccs5.4 烧写u-boot到nandflash
烧写用到的工具是 nand-flash-writer.out它的源码路径在 ${EZSDK}/board-support/host-tools/src/nandflash-.tar.gz解压后导入到ccs进行编译后得到 nand-flash-writer.out。接着:①导入8168.gel文件②将u-boot.noxip.bin 先存放在电脑中③Run原创 2013-12-04 12:03:42 · 2705 阅读 · 0 评论 -
DM8168 unrecoverable error: OMX_ErrorBadParameter (0x80001005) [resolved]
DM8168 custom board 成功启动系统之后想先测一下8168编解码功能,把开发包里的examples跑一遍。启动完成后,连上HDMI显示,在starting Matrix GUI application后HDMI已经有输出了,这时候优先选择了decode_display功能来测试。root@8168:/usr/share/ti/ti-omx# ./decode_display_a原创 2014-10-30 20:04:08 · 3296 阅读 · 0 评论 -
DM8168 CameraLink 视频噪点问题解决
几天前写过FPGA采集LVDS视频(噪点去除),当时的情况是CameraLink视频出现了很多噪点,不堪入目,硬件方面没有找到毛病,只能是用硬件描述语言对采集前端的FPGA重新进行了处理,效果上有所改善,实际上是自己在骗自己,硬件上有缺陷,视频数据源不准确的情况下,怎么处理都不太可能达到完美的效果。当时分析了四个可能性:①DS90CR288解串芯片供电不足。②差分线阻抗和100欧电阻不匹配原创 2014-11-10 19:19:19 · 2119 阅读 · 1 评论 -
DM8168 nandflash启动出现卡死(解决)
上次写了篇笔记,记录了一下DM8168 nandflash的启动失败信息。我在里面分析了一下,然后写了一句:不过这三种情况停止的地方是固定的,是电源原因的可能性不是太大。……结果nandflash启动不起的原因就是电源的原因!!!这分析能力也太给力了……这个电源是EVM_1V0_AVS ,核使用电压。因为画板子的时候不知道这个电源的重要性,所以很草率的没有注意电源传原创 2013-12-17 18:52:54 · 2500 阅读 · 2 评论 -
DM8168板第一次有串口输出数据
手焊了好久,调试了好久,终于DDR3(796M)、SD卡测试正常设置成SD卡启动结果启动信息是这个:U-Boot 2010.06 (Dec 09 2011 - 12:31:16)原创 2013-11-29 13:19:00 · 1757 阅读 · 0 评论 -
DM6437-读写DDR测试过程
硬件平台:DM6437EVM调试工具:CCS3.3DDR读写程序:Uint32 memfill32( Uint32 start, Uint32 len, Uint32 val ){ Uint32 i; Uint32 end = start + len; Uint32 errorcount = 0; /* Write Pattern */原创 2013-11-26 14:11:42 · 3963 阅读 · 1 评论 -
DM8168 DVRRDK DSP算法开发(OSD)
1 系统编译① Linux端(A8)编译命令:make –s dvr_rdk_linux在文件夹DVRRDK_04.01.00.02/dvr_rdk/bin/ti816x/bin/生成dvr_rdk_demo_mcfw_api.outlinux可执行程序,需要将该应用程序移动到下列目录并覆盖:DVRRDK_04.01.00.02/target/rfs_816原创 2016-01-04 10:22:47 · 3896 阅读 · 6 评论